Arsenal will have to fight off Premier League competition if they want to sign target Steven Nzonzi, as West Ham and Everton enter the race for the talented midfielder, according to French news outlet Le10Sport.
What's the story?
The 29-year-old midfielder will be familiar to English football fans as he spent eight years playing here with Blackburn Rovers then with Stoke City.
After he moved to Sevilla in 2015, the rangy French international found another level and has impressed over the last few seasons for the Spanish club, making 90 appearances in La Liga, registering seven goals and six assists.
Now according to the report, the three English clubs are set to battle it out for the Sevilla enforcer although no formal bid has been made for the player who is valued at £27million on Transfermarkt.
